WebFeb 7, 2024 · To apply the formatting, you simply go to the Home tab &gt; Conditional Formatting &gt; Highlight Cell Rules and select A Date Occurring. Select one of the date options from the drop-down list in the left-hand part … WebJan 24, 2024 · On the Home tab of the ribbon, select Conditional Formatting &gt; New Rule... Select 'Format only cells that contain'. Leave the first drop-down set to 'Cell Value'. Set the second drop-down to 'less than'. Enter the formula =TODAY () in the box next to it. Click Format... Activate the Font tab. Select red as color. Click OK, then click OK again.
